Mixing the Ingredients: Tips for Achieving the Right Consistency

Creating the perfect savory mini meatballs begins with the careful mixing of ingredients. The key to achieving the right consistency is to strike a balance between moisture and structure. Start by combining your ground meat—whether it be beef, turkey, or chicken—with the breadcrumbs and eggs in a large mixing bowl.

To ensure even distribution of flavors, consider using your hands for mixing, but be cautious not to overwork the meat. Overmixing can lead to dense meatballs, while gentle folding will help maintain a light texture. The ideal mixture should feel slightly tacky but not overly wet. If it feels too dry, add a splash of milk or broth; if it’s too wet, incorporate a bit more breadcrumbs. A well-mixed meatball mixture will contribute to a tender, juicy final product.

Shaping the Meatballs: Ideal Size and Spacing for Even Cooking

Once your mixture is ready, it’s time to shape the meatballs. Aim for golf ball-sized portions, approximately 1 to 1.5 inches in diameter. This size ensures that they cook evenly and maintain a pleasing bite. Use a small ice cream scoop or your hands to form the meat into rounds, ensuring they are compact but not overly pressed.

When placing the meatballs on a baking sheet, ensure there is enough space between each one—about an inch apart. This spacing allows heat to circulate, promoting even cooking and browning. For those opting for frying, make sure not to overcrowd the pan, as this can lead to steaming rather than browning.

Monitoring Doneness: How to Check if Meatballs are Cooked Thoroughly

To guarantee that your savory mini meatballs are cooked to perfection, you’ll need to monitor their doneness. The best way to check is by using a meat thermometer. Insert the thermometer into the center of a meatball; it should read 160°F (71°C) for ground beef or pork, and 165°F (74°C) for turkey or chicken.

If you don’t have a thermometer, you can also cut one meatball in half to check the color. The inside should be fully cooked, showing no pinkness, and the juices should run clear. Ensuring that the meatballs are adequately cooked not only enhances flavor but is essential for food safety.

Importance of Simmering Meatballs in Sauce: Flavor Infusion and Moisture Retention

Simmering the meatballs in sauce not only infuses them with rich flavors but also helps retain moisture, resulting in a succulent bite. As the meatballs simmer, they absorb the sauce’s essence, enhancing their overall taste. Aim to simmer the meatballs in the sauce for at least 20 minutes, allowing enough time for the flavors to meld together.

This technique also serves as a great way to keep the meatballs warm before serving, making it a practical choice for gatherings or family dinners.

Variations to the Classic Recipe

To keep things exciting, don’t hesitate to experiment with variations on the classic meatball recipe.

Alternative Meat Options: Ground turkey or chicken can provide a lighter alternative while still delivering on flavor. For a vegetarian option, consider using lentils, chickpeas, or mushrooms to create a satisfying meatball substitute.

Ingredient Swaps for Dietary Needs: If you or your guests have dietary restrictions, there are plenty of ingredient swaps you can make. Use gluten-free breadcrumbs or oats for a gluten-free version, and replace dairy with almond milk or nutritional yeast for a dairy-free adaptation.

Easy Meatball Recipe

Discover the joy of creating Savory Mini Meatballs Delight, a comfort food that appeals to everyone! This easy recipe combines flavorful ground beef or pork with Italian seasonings, breadcrumbs, and parmesan cheese for irresistibly tender morsels. Perfect for family dinners or as appetizers at parties, these mini meatballs can be paired with pasta, served in marinara sauce, or enjoyed on their own. Experience the warmth of homemade cooking that brings people together.

Ingredients
  

1 pound ground beef (or a mix of beef and pork)

1 cup breadcrumbs (preferably Italian seasoned)

1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ese

1/4 cup chopped fresh parsley (or 2 tablespoons dried)

1/4 cup milk

1 large egg

2 cloves garlic, minced

1 teaspoon onion powder

1 teaspoon dried oregano

1 teaspoon salt

1/2 teaspoon black pepper

1/2 teaspoon red pepper flakes (optional, for a bit of heat)

2 cups marinara sauce (store-bought or homemade)

Instructions
 

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per or spray it with cooking spray.

    Mix the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, combine the ground beef, breadcrumbs, parmesan cheese, parsley, milk, egg, minced garlic, onion powder, oregano, salt, black pepper, and red pepper flakes if using. Mix well until just combined – avoid overmixing to keep the meatballs tender.

      Form the Meatballs: Using your hands, shape the mixture into small meatballs, about 1 inch in diameter, and place them on the prepared baking sheet. Ensure they’re spaced evenly apart to allow proper cooking.

        Bake the Meatballs: Bake in the preheated oven for 18-20 minutes or until they are browned and cooked through, reaching an internal temperature of 160°F (70°C).

          Simmer in Sauce: While the meatballs are baking, heat your marinara sauce in a large skillet over medium heat. Once the meatballs are done, gently transfer them to the sauce and simmer for an additional 5-10 minutes, allowing them to soak up the flavors.

            Serve: Serve the meatballs hot, ideally over spaghetti, with garlic bread, or as tasty appetizers. Garnish with extra parsley or parmesan if desired.

              Prep Time, Total Time, Servings: 15 minutes | 35 minutes | 4-6 servings
